Impact of CYP3A5*3 on CYP3A activity and the activation of clopidogrel in human liver S9 fraction

  To evaluate the effect of the cytochrome P450(CYP) 3A5 polymorphisms on the CYP3A activity and the activation of the clopidogrel in human liver S9 fraction.CYP3A5*3 genotypes of 40 liver tissues were determined by the TaqMan allele discrimination assay.CYP3A enzyme activity was measured by a high performance liquid chromatography (HPLC) and the concentration of clopidogrel and its active metabolites (MP-H3, MP-H4) were measured by a HPLC-MS/MS method.The effect of the polymorphism on the CYP3A enzymes activity and the activation of clopidogrel was accessed.Of 40 liver tissues, the frequencies of CYP3A5*1/*1, CYP3A5*1/*3 and CYP3A5*3/*3 were 0.675, 0.25, and 0.075, respectively.Non-genetic factors, including gender, age, hypertension, had no significant influence on CYP3A enzyme activity in liver S9 fraction (P > 0.05).CYP3A activity and the concentrations of active metabolites MP-H4 of clopidogrel was significantly lower in liver S9 fraction with CYP3A5*3/*3 than that with CYP3A5*1/*1 or CYP3A5*1/*3 (P < 0.05).There was a significant positive correlation between the concentration of MP-H4 and CYP3A enzyme activity (r =0.435).The results indicated that the CYP3A5*3/*3 genotype could significantly reduce CYP3A enzyme activity and affect the activation of clopidogrel in liver tissues.
